#SHEisIPA – Empowering Female Leaders – in the IPA and Beyond
12th April - 17th April
Content
The #SHEisIPA team are delighted to deliver the ‘Empowering Female Leaders – in the IPA and Beyond’ seminar, which will focus on the role of ‘leadership’ from both an International Police Association, academic and practitioner perspective, with contributions from leadership professionals across the world.
Target group:
Women who are already in leadership positions or want to become leaders, whether in law enforcement or in the IPA; those who want to work on their own professional development.
Objectives of the event:
At the end of this seminar, you will feel confident enough to apply for the position you want to have.
You will understand different leadership styles and applications in the workplace
You will be aware of current academic research which helps shape the way leadership roles are undertaken
You will learn soft skills about personal presence and confidence
You will understand the basics about how the IPA is structured and the leadership roles within it.
Besides interesting and professionally relevant presentations provided by experienced leaders, the seminar will have practical exercises to enable you to work with colleagues to improve skills. The seminar program will include current topics like the New Work concept, mental health, Inclusive Leadership, and digital leadership. After every input there will be a practical workshop.
